How do you roast pork tenderloin?

Place in the oven and bake uncovered at 400 degree F for 13-15 minutes, flipping the tenderloin over halfway through baking. Bake until center of pork registers 150 degree F then transfer to a cutting board and let meat rest 5-10 min. Slice into rings and serve.
What temperature do you cook pork tenderloin in the oven?

The National Pork Board recommends cooking pork chops, roasts, and tenderlointo an internal temperature between 145° F. (medium rare) and 160° F. (medium), followed by a 3 minute rest. How long do you cook a pork tenderloin in oven?

Place pork loin into oven, turning and basting with pan liquids. Cook until the pork is no longer pink in the center, about 1 hour.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read 145 degrees F (63 degrees C). Remove roast to a platter.
